MUTINY ON THE RINGS

First to recommend

Description

Buy the DVD on www.mutinyontherings.com or in person at Santa Monica original muscle beach, south of the Santa Monica pier where ringmaster Bruno Angelico swings every Sunday (French guy in a beret). The DVD captures L.A.'s unique "subculture" of renegades at Venice Beach's traveling rings + allows ground-bound viewers to vicariously fly.

molo design soft wall

First to recommend

Description

Freestanding, lightweight, expandable "honeycomb" partition wall made of paper. Genius design, renewable materials... great for a person like me with a loft. Removes the notion of fixed, static living. Creates malleability of space.
